In 1970, Oldsmobile produced what would be the ultimate iteration
of the 442 model. In response to new regulations, Oldsmobile made
their mighty 455 cubic inch V-8 standard while keeping their
excellent four-speed manual transmission. This gargantuan engine
produced 365 horsepower and 500 foot-pounds of torque, more than
enough to take on competitors in the never-ending American muscle
car horsepower war.
This 1970 Oldsmobile 442 Convertible was sold new through
Wisecarver Oldsmobile of Berryville, Virginia. The beneficiary of a
professional frame-off restoration, it is finished in Sherwood
Green with a white top. The exterior sports a ram air hood and dual
sport mirrors. The 455 cu. in. V-8 engine is paired to a four-speed
manual transmission. The Parchment interior features bucket seats,
a console, AM/FM radio, and clock. It is equipped with a power top,
power steering, and power brakes. The car is accompanied by a copy
of its build sheet, spare tire, and jack.To view this car and
